declare namespace javax { namespace sql { /** * An object that implements the RowSetWriter interface, * called a writer. A writer may be registered with a RowSet * object that supports the reader/writer paradigm. *

* If a disconnected RowSet object modifies some of its data, * and it has a writer associated with it, it may be implemented so that it * calls on the writer's writeData method internally * to write the updates back to the data source. In order to do this, the writer * must first establish a connection with the rowset's data source. *

* If the data to be updated has already been changed in the data source, there * is a conflict, in which case the writer will not write * the changes to the data source. The algorithm the writer uses for preventing * or limiting conflicts depends entirely on its implementation. * @since 1.4 */ // @ts-ignore interface RowSetWriter { /** * Writes the changes in this RowSetWriter object's * rowset back to the data source from which it got its data. * @param caller the RowSet object (1) that has implemented the * RowSetInternal interface, (2) with which this writer is * registered, and (3) that called this method internally * @return true if the modified data was written; false * if not, which will be the case if there is a conflict * @exception SQLException if a database access error occurs */ // @ts-ignore writeData(caller: javax.sql.RowSetInternal): boolean } } }
